Nine juvenile delinquents fled from a government-run observation home in Sethi Colony in Jaipur after breaking a bathroom wall on Monday night, police said today. "There is no CCTV camera installed in the area from where the juveniles fled.Still, we have managed to nab one of them. We have repeatedly written to the observation home administration to beef-up security and renovate old building but our reminders have fallen on deaf ears," Transport Nagar Police Station SHO in-charge Om Prakash said..
